UPSB220 Uninterruptible Power Supply Caterpillar


Unit Upgrade

Usage:

UPSB 220 JFA
The information in this section provides the procedure to perform a field upgrade to change the commercial kVA rating for the UPS.

Safety

Refer to the Operation and Maintenance Manual, SEBU8274, "General Hazard Information" section for safety-related information.

Personal protection equipment is required for safety:

  • 11 cal arc flash suit

  • 20 cal arc flash hood

  • Electrical safety gloves

  • Safety glasses

Upgrade Procedure

Note: A laptop computer with Soft Tuner software and a null modem cable are required.

The procedure assumes the UPSB220 is currently powered up and running in the normal mode.

  1. The appropriate personnel must put on the required PPE.



    Illustration 1g02554617

  1. Press the gray inverter off button (1) on the UPSB220 control panel to turn off the inverter. The unit will transfer to static bypass .

  1. Close Q3BP.

  1. Open Q5N, QF1, and Q1.

  1. Connect null modem cable to the COSI board. The COSI board is located on the UPS door. The COSI board is also referred to as the Media Contacts 11 board.

  1. Connect the null modem cable to laptop that has the UPS Soft Tuner software installed.

  1. Open the Soft Tuner application.

  1. Select "Connect" after the initial Soft Tuner dialog appears.

  1. Once the computer is connected with the UPS, select "Refresh all".

  1. Select the "Configure" tab on the menu bar. Click "Personalize" from the drop-down menu.

  1. The "PERSONALIZATION" dialog will appear. Select the commercial power rating that is listed in the parameters column.

  1. Enter the desired upgraded kVA value in the commercial power rating field at the bottom of the dialog.

  1. Click off to the side of the commercial power rating field. The text in the field will change to red if the change is successful. The upgraded kVA value will also be displayed in the UPS Tuner column.

  1. Click on the "Send" button.

  1. The "SEND CONDITIONS" dialog will appear. Click "OK" on the "SEND CONDITIONS" dialog.

    Note: All of the configuration instructions that are listed in the dialog must be completed for the procedure.

  1. A dialog will appear that informs the user that the personalization has been sent successfully to the UPS unit. Click "OK".

  1. Provide the factory with the serial number of the UPS unit to receive a new label for the door.
